diff options
author | Arnold Schwaighofer <arnolds@codeaurora.org> | 2012-08-13 19:54:01 +0000 |
---|---|---|
committer | Arnold Schwaighofer <arnolds@codeaurora.org> | 2012-08-13 19:54:01 +0000 |
commit | 0bb7f23cfc9b7b27d45c6f3c4f75dd5850f98dbb (patch) | |
tree | b075770b00b1ca65e71ca9c45f6b0ea35d43fbc0 /llvm/lib/CodeGen/StackProtector.cpp | |
parent | 9746b33e26957bdaafbaa956de444c0453abde2b (diff) | |
download | llvm-0bb7f23cfc9b7b27d45c6f3c4f75dd5850f98dbb.zip llvm-0bb7f23cfc9b7b27d45c6f3c4f75dd5850f98dbb.tar.gz llvm-0bb7f23cfc9b7b27d45c6f3c4f75dd5850f98dbb.tar.bz2 |
[Hexagon] Don't mark callee saved registers as clobbered by a tail call
This was causing unnecessary spills/restores of callee saved registers.
Fixes PR13572.
Patch by Pranav Bhandarkar!
llvm-svn: 161778
Diffstat (limited to 'llvm/lib/CodeGen/StackProtector.cpp')
0 files changed, 0 insertions, 0 deletions